Developing A Forest Growth Monitoring Model Using Thematic Mappery Imagery

Abstrract Recently most investigations in satellite-based remotely sensed data has concentrated upon the biophysical characteristics of vegetation for large area, little attention has been given to the allometric relationship of tree and reflectance to the recorded pixel value. In this research crown width and/or canopy closure was associated with pixel value in terms of their surface-exposure to satellite sensors. Given the fact that planted-tree crown closure is correlated with their height and diameter at breast height (dbh) in early stages of the plantations, it is expected that a relationship exists between tree canopy closure, height, dbh and their associated reflectance-values. The proposed concept was tested in a case study for planted black spruce (Picea mariana) using Landsat Thematic Mapper (TM).
